PLEASE PLEASE PLEASE - DO NOT USE!
In 2015 I converted from oil to gas and used Flynn Aire who also installed a water tank that is ran by gas.

In 2016, I had a gas leak in my house I call Flynn Aire's emergency number several times and never received a call back so I had to hire and pay for a plumber to fix the issues. I was told by that plumber that the connections from the furnace to the water heater, during the installation, wasn't connected correctly and I had a slow gas leak going on for a while.

Now in 2020 I had another gas leak. National Grid was called and found one leak, but they shut off my gas immediately because he said there was definitely more leaks and that we needed to hire a plumber to do an air pressure test to see where the other ones were coming from. The plumber told me that I had 3 separate gas leaks that came from the new pipes installed in my home that was the result of the installation. The sealant used during the installation was no good and was wearing off.
After the issue was fixed, I contacted Flynn Aire because I wanted them to reimburse me for the plumbing costs since this was the result of their work. I requested to speak with the owner, Bob Hansen, several times, who would not return my calls, instead he had the their manager Matt intervene the calls and said that they would not reimburse us for work that was done by a plumber and that I should have called them first.

I explained to Matt, that before I hired the plumber, I didn't know that the as leak was because of the shabby work they did and they still refused to help with the bill. I did not request that the whole bill be paid but at least half.

I don't think that after 5 years I should be having these issues and the sad part is that they don't back up their work. Like the saying goes - you get what you pay for.

PLEASE DO NOT USE - They put my family in a very dangerous situation last week and I don't want I anyone to be in this situation

Review: My business relocated from one store in ths shopping center to another. The day after moving in, I noticed an issue with the air in the front of the store is almost non-existent while the rear of the store is cold. I have an air conditioning contract with Flynn Aire. I called and advised them I had moved and need to schedule a maintenance at the new location. There seems to be a problem with the air circulating correctly. A date was scheduled for June [redacted]. On that date Flynn Aire called & cancelled citing two techs out & they couldnt get to use. They rescheduled for the following Wednesday, July [redacted]. Meanwhile, women are working out in an environment that reached 80 degrees. The service tech did arrive on July [redacted] to analysis the unit. My manager explained what the problem was & the solution her brother (whose a contractor) indicated. The tech called back & forth to Flynn Aire several times with questions about our type of unit. It didnot seem as if he was confident in his determination of the problem. When he wrote up the report, he wrote exactly what my manager told him the problem was when he arrived. We were told we needed a part. No one called to let us know how long the part would take. When we called July [redacted], a customer service rep was very nasty to us and hung up. After calling again on July [redacted], we were told it wasn't a part we need but duct modification. A date for July ** was set btwn 11-1pm. I closed Curves in anticipation of the repair. No one arrived by 1:30 so we called again. The techs were still at the 1st job but should be there shortly. We called again at 4:10pm & was told it's a 2 man job and a 2nd tech was being located but they'd call us. By 9:30pm I left the store disgusted. I called again Sat 7/** & left a message with the answering service. No one has called to date.Desired Settlement: Next week we are going to experience a heat wave. Curves is an excercise facility for older women. Lack of air conditioning while exerting themselves poses a true health concern. A few have already said they will return when the air returns. One lady almost passed out and left the second time when she began to overheat. On a busy Monday, attendance can reach 120 members. I MUST have a stable exercise enviroment to avoid a potentially dangerous health issue.
